Subject: Snapshot testing cut-over complete

Team — the migration of Brindleworks UI components to the new Mirrorpane snapshot harness finished last night. Legacy golden files were regenerated, flaky animation frames are now masked, and CI gates on pixel diffs above threshold. Future maintainers: update snapshots only via the approved script, never by hand. The harness runs against the configuration values listed below.

config for yadug-kahip:
[kelys]
host = kelys.torvahq.local
user = kelys_svc
database = kelys_prod

**TaxHive Cache — Onboarding Note (Weekly Eng Sync)**

TaxHive is our tax-rate lookup cache sitting in front of the Ledgermint rates service. It warms on deploy, holds rates for 24 hours, and invalidates by jurisdiction key. New joiners should know: the cache node in the Velmora region runs with an encrypted snapshot volume, and restoring it after a failed deploy requires manual unlock. Flushing without unlocking first will corrupt the warm set, so always unlock before flush. For restores, use the recovery passphrase noted directly below.

unlock words, fahop-yageg: ralwyn-kelath

## 2.8.1 — Key rotation

Rotated the signing key for the Crashline ingest pipeline after the old one hit its 90-day expiry. Updated the symbolication workers and the upload gateway; both verified against staging builds from the Fenwick app. No schema or API changes. Reviewer: confirm the CI secret matches what's checked into the vault manifest. New pipeline builds must verify against the key below.

deploy key for kajof-fajop: bky6_gDHw9Q

Board Briefing — Leadership Review

Kestrel Holdings has agreed terms to divest its Marrowgate Logistics unit to Tarnfield Group. Consideration: cash, payable at close, subject to working-capital adjustment. Headcount transfers in full; no redundancies anticipated. Regulatory clearance expected within ninety days. Proceeds earmarked for debt reduction and the Ostenvale platform build. Finlay Crест leads completion. Rationale and forward intent are set out in the confidential note below.

internal memo for kawip-hadug: Headcount on the Wenwyn team goes from 7 to 140 by the end of January. Gross margin on Wenwyn came in at 20 percent against a plan of 15 percent.